Subject: Cleaning crew — Tower B access

Facilities,

The Brightmop crew starts tonight, 21:00–01:00, Tower B floors 2–4 only. They sign in at the front desk, no exceptions. Escort not required after first night. Loading dock stays locked; they use the east stairwell door. Log any issues in the shift book. The stairwell door needs the temporary pass code, which is as follows.

door code, tagef-bajop: bdg-SB-7

## Formula sandbox tuning

User-supplied formulas in Gridmoor execute inside a restricted interpreter with hard ceilings on time, memory, and call depth. Reviewers should confirm any change to these ceilings is justified in the PR description, since raising them widens the abuse surface. Defaults were chosen from production traces. The current limits are as follows.

limits module of tafog-fawip:
WEIGHTS = {
    "julix": 57,
    "lamys": 992,
    "kasvan": 209,
    "quenok": 750,
    "alddor": 259,
    "oliath": 1009,
    "wenix": 815,
}

## Ticket #—: Address autocomplete returning empty results

The Lanequill autocomplete widget on the staging checkout page stopped returning suggestions after yesterday's redeploy. Root cause: the widget's environment file was regenerated from an outdated template and the geocoder section is incomplete. Fix: open widget.env on the staging host, confirm the geocoder endpoint line matches the Lanequill staging region, and restore the missing geocoder credential on the line immediately after the endpoint.

vault entry, yahif-yajep: COURIER_KEY29=b802bdf8034096b65a51c6ba5abe2